Comparing 1.26 Inch vs 1 Inch Thickness

HOKINETY upgraded this rope from the standard 1-inch to 1.26-inch thickness, which increases strength and durability. The thicker diameter provides more grip surface for hand handling and resists abrasion better. For heavy vehicles over 8,000lbs, the extra thickness provides meaningful additional safety margin.

Break Strength Rating Transparency

This rope advertises 55,000lbs as the break strength, which represents the maximum tested strength. Some premium brands list minimum break strength instead, which is a more conservative rating. The difference matters because minimum break strength guarantees every rope meets that threshold, while maximum break strength means at least one sample reached that number during testing.

Soft Shackles vs D-Ring Shackles

Soft shackles offer several advantages over traditional metal D-ring shackles. They are lighter, will not scratch paint or damage recovery points, and will not become dangerous projectiles if a failure occurs. The downside is they can be more susceptible to abrasion and UV damage over time. For most recreational off-roaders, soft shackles are the safer and more convenient choice.

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Tow Strap?

Choosing the right tow strap or recovery strap comes down to understanding three key things: what type of strap you need, what capacity matches your vehicle, and what connection method works with your recovery points. This guide walks through each decision.

Tow Straps vs Recovery Straps: What Is the Difference?

Tow straps are made from polyester, which has minimal stretch around 2%. They typically feature metal hooks and are designed for pulling a freely rolling vehicle on flat ground. Use them for roadside emergencies where a vehicle breaks down and needs to be towed to a shop.

Recovery straps are made from nylon, which stretches 10-30% under load. They have loop ends instead of hooks and are designed for kinetic recovery where the towing vehicle gets a running start to yank a stuck vehicle free. The stretch stores kinetic energy that creates a smoother, safer pull.

The danger is using a tow strap for recovery. Without stretch, the sudden shock load can snap the strap, damage recovery points, or turn metal hooks into dangerous projectiles. Always match the strap type to the task.

Break Strength vs Working Load Limit

Break strength, also called Minimum Break Strength or MBS, is the load at which the strap will fail. It is the absolute maximum capacity before the strap breaks. You should never approach this number in actual use.

Working Load Limit (WLL) is typically 10-15% of the break strength. This is the maximum load you should apply during normal use. For example, a strap with 30,000lb break strength might have a working load limit of around 10,000lbs.

The rule of thumb for recovery is to choose a strap with a break strength at least 2 to 3 times your vehicle’s GVWR (Gross Vehicle Weight Rating). A 5,000lb vehicle needs a strap rated for at least 10,000-15,000lbs break strength.

20ft vs 30ft: Choosing the Right Length

20-foot straps are the most common and work well for most towing and recovery situations. They keep vehicles close together, which is fine for on-road towing and straightforward recovery pulls. Most budget and mid-range straps come in this length.

30-foot straps give you more distance between vehicles, which matters for kinetic recovery where the towing vehicle needs room to build momentum. In off-road situations with obstacles between vehicles, the extra length provides flexibility. Many users on overlanding forums recommend having both lengths for different situations.

Connection Methods: Hooks, D-Rings, and Soft Shackles

Metal hooks are the easiest to attach but also the least secure for recovery situations. They work fine for flat towing but can slip or snap under shock loads. Always use hooks with keeper clips or safety latches.

D-ring shackles connect to loop ends and provide a secure, reliable attachment point. They are the standard for off-road recovery and are rated for specific load capacities. Make sure the shackle rating exceeds your strap’s working load limit.

Soft shackles are the newest option and offer advantages in weight, safety, and paint protection. They will not become dangerous projectiles if a failure occurs. The trade-off is potential susceptibility to abrasion and UV damage over time.

Safety Checklist Before Any Recovery

Before attempting any vehicle recovery, always inspect your strap for cuts, fraying, or chemical damage. Never stand between the two vehicles during a recovery pull. Place a recovery damper or blanket over the middle of the strap to absorb energy if the strap breaks. Communicate clearly between both drivers before starting the pull. And never exceed the working load limit of any component in your recovery system.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a tow strap and a recovery strap?

Tow straps are made from rigid polyester with minimal stretch and metal hooks, designed for towing freely rolling vehicles on flat ground. Recovery straps are made from stretchy nylon with loop ends, designed to stretch and store kinetic energy for yanking stuck vehicles free from mud, sand, or snow.

What break strength do I need for my vehicle?

Choose a strap with a break strength at least 2 to 3 times your vehicle GVWR. For example, a 5,000lb vehicle needs a strap rated for at least 10,000 to 15,000lbs break strength. This safety margin accounts for the increased forces during recovery, especially in mud or sand where suction adds resistance.

Can I use a tow strap for off-road recovery?

No, you should never use a tow strap for off-road recovery. Tow straps have no stretch, so the sudden shock load can snap the strap, damage recovery points, or turn metal hooks into dangerous projectiles. Always use a nylon recovery strap or kinetic rope with loop ends for off-road recovery situations.

Do I need a 20-foot or 30-foot strap?

A 20-foot strap works for most on-road towing and basic recovery situations. A 30-foot strap gives the towing vehicle more room to build momentum for kinetic recovery, which is important when pulling vehicles from deep mud, sand, or snow. Many experienced off-roaders carry both lengths for different scenarios.

How do I properly connect a tow strap to my vehicle?

Connect tow straps with hooks to factory tow points or recovery hooks, ensuring the keeper clip is engaged. For recovery straps with loop ends, use D-ring shackles or soft shackles threaded through the loop and attached to a rated recovery point. Never attach straps to bumpers, axle components, or non-rated points, as these can fail under load.
